Kallypso Masters writes emotional romance novels with dominant males and the women who can bring them to their knees. Most of her stories have BDSM elements. Currently, she lives with the three Masters at Arms Doms (Adam, Marc, and Damián)—and, yes, they tend to dominate her life. (Actually, they only dominate her mind. She has been married for 28 years to the man who provided her own Happily Ever After and they have two adult children.)
In April 2011, she quit her “day job” to pursue a full-time writing career. Masters at Arms is her first published novel. Of course, there are many others in various stages of development and completion written over the past 35 years that never will see the light of day.
Kally’s RESCUE ME series begins with MASTERS AT ARMS, the introduction to the series. On Sept. 30, the release of NOBODY'S ANGEL tells of the rocky road of Master Marc’s romance with Angelina, complicated by his SAR partner and friend Luke. In December, NOBODY'S HERO will tell of the romance of Karla and Master Adam. (Does he really stand a chance against Karla, who already brought him to his knees twice?) And, in February, NOBODY'S PERFECT provides the much-needed Happily Ever After for the broken, tortured souls—Savannah (Savi) and Master Damián, Kallypso Masters’ first sado-masochistic (SM) romance.

Nobody's Angel
Marc d'Alessio might own a BDSM club with his fellow military veterans, Adam and Damián, but he keeps all women at a distance. However, when Marc rescues beautiful Angelina Giardano from a disastrous first BDSM experience at the club, an uncharacteristic attraction leaves him torn between his safe, but lonely world, and a possible future with his angel. Angelina leaves BDSM behind, only to have her dreams plagued by the Italian angel who rescued her at the club. When she meets Marc at a bar in her hometown, she can't shake the feeling she knows him—but has no idea why he reminds her of her angel. When Marc's search-and-rescue partner, widower Luke Denton, confides he believes Angelina is the angel his wife promised to send him, Marc is convinced she is meant for Luke. A painful incident from his past keeps Marc from letting any woman drive a wedge between him and a friend. While Luke can provide Angelina with love and stability, Marc knows his friend can't satisfy her submissive needs. Marc offers one night to show her that BDSM is not about pain, but a power exchange with mutual trust and consent. But he knows he can’t commit emotionally to anything more. When the abusive Dom from Angelina's past threatens, Marc's protective instincts kick in; he must keep her safe. Again at the Masters at Arms Club, she turns the tables on him—and turns his safe, controlled world upside down.

Masters at Arms
Masters at Arms begins the journey of three men, each on a quest for honor, acceptance, and to ease his unspoken pain. Their paths cross at one of the darkest points in their lives. As they try to come to terms with the aftermath of Iraq--forging an unbreakable bond--they band together to start their own BDSM club. But will they ever truly become masters of their own fates? Or would fate become masters of them? (Book One in the Rescue Me series.)
NOTE FROM AUTHOR: This is an introduction to the erotic-romance series RESCUE ME, but does NOT have the HEAs that will come in the three romance novels to follow in the series. There are some intense themes in the book, including death of a spouse, incest, sex slave torture, and amputation.
